> The development of Firebug is discontinued. See 
> https://blog.getfirebug.com/2016/06/07/unifying-firebug-firefox-devtools/.
> Firebug won't work anymore once multi-process Firefox 
> <https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/Firefox/Multiprocess_Firefox> is 
> enabled and features like the Script panel are already starting to break. 
> Therefore you are advised to switch to the Firefox DevTools 
> <https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Tools> instead (which provide a 
> Firebug theme to make the transition not too hard).

>> since the new Firefox upgrade to version 50.0 with Firebug version 
>> 2.0.18, it is triggering an error on angular based sites. Basically I can 
>> load the site with Firebug switched off, then I can open it and inspect the 
>> elements and works fine. But if I load the site (or refresh the page) with 
>> the plugin switched on then it fires the error.
>>
>> The error is this one: 
>>
>> TypeError: dbg is undefined 
>> debuggerLib.js (line 556)
>>
>> I've tried to uninstall Firebug, rename the profile folder and reinstall 
>> it as described in here 
>> http://stackoverflow.com/questions/27184191/typeerror-dbg-is-undefined-in-angularjs?answertab=active#tab-top
>>  
>> but nothing changed.
